What Entrepreneurial Lessons I Had to Unlearn to Build a $1 Billion Business

Introduction

As a child of entrepreneurs, I was immersed in a world where hustle, innovation, and risk-taking were daily norms. Yet, as I embarked on my own entrepreneurial journey, I found that the lessons taught at home weren't always conducive to building a billion-dollar business. In fact, I had to unlearn some of those deep-rooted beliefs.

Understanding Entrepreneurship

Entrepreneurship is often romanticized. We envision success stories and groundbreaking innovations, yet the reality is fraught with challenges and setbacks. As I navigated my own path, I realized that some of the cherished ideals from my childhood needed to be reevaluated.

"Success in business isn't solely about persistence; it's about adaptability and intelligence in decision-making."

Key Lessons Unlearned

  • Risk is Not Always Rewarding: In my family, taking risks equated to potential success. However, as I analyzed market trends and consumer behaviors, I learned that calculated risks often yield better outcomes than reckless ones.
  • Networking is Essential: I had always assumed that hard work was enough. But as I delved deeper into the business world, I recognized the importance of building networks and strategic partnerships.
  • Embrace Failure as a Teacher: Growing up, failure was seen as an embarrassment. However, embracing failure became one of the most important lessons I learned. Each setback provided invaluable insights.
  • Financial Acumen is Crucial: My initial focus was on ideation and concept development, but I had to shift my mindset to include a greater emphasis on financial literacy—understanding cash flow, budgeting, and investment strategies.
  • Inclusivity Drives Innovation: I grew up believing that business was about individual prowess. Yet, I learned that diverse teams often produce the most innovative solutions.

Real-world Implications

In today's rapidly changing business landscape, these lessons carry significant weight. As entrepreneurship evolves with the integration of technology and changing consumer preferences, understanding these dynamics can make the difference between success and failure. Every entrepreneur must be willing to unlearn outdated notions and embrace a more flexible approach.

The Role of Technology

Technology has altered the fabric of entrepreneurship. With access to analytics and data-driven decision-making, the ability to pivot quickly becomes essential. In my own experience, leveraging technology not only enhanced efficiency but also opened doors to innovative business models.

Conclusion

Part of growing as an entrepreneur is understanding that the journey is continuous. I continue to confront old beliefs and adapt to new realities, and I encourage aspiring entrepreneurs to do the same. By critically assessing and unlearning certain principles, we can better prepare ourselves for future challenges and opportunities.
